About N-[4-[2-(3,4-dihydro-2H-quinolin-1-yl)-2-oxoethyl]sulfanylphenyl]-2-fluorobenzamide
N-[4-[2-(3,4-dihydro-2H-quinolin-1-yl)-2-oxoethyl]sulfanylphenyl]-2-fluorobenzamide (PubChem CID 22777398) has the molecular formula C24H21FN2O2S
and a molecular weight of 420.51 g/mol. Its IUPAC name is N-[4-[2-(3,4-dihydro-2H-quinolin-1-yl)-2-oxoethyl]sulfanylphenyl]-2-fluorobenzamide.

What is the SMILES notation for N-[4-[2-(3,4-dihydro-2H-quinolin-1-yl)-2-oxoethyl]sulfanylphenyl]-2-fluorobenzamide?
The canonical SMILES for N-[4-[2-(3,4-dihydro-2H-quinolin-1-yl)-2-oxoethyl]sulfanylphenyl]-2-fluorobenzamide is O=C(Nc1ccc(SCC(=O)N2CCCc3ccccc32)cc1)c1ccccc1F.
What is the InChIKey of N-[4-[2-(3,4-dihydro-2H-quinolin-1-yl)-2-oxoethyl]sulfanylphenyl]-2-fluorobenzamide?
The InChIKey is PPTDOQYCDZELKS-UHFFFAOYSA-N. The full InChI is InChI=1S/C24H21FN2O2S/c25-21-9-3-2-8-20(21)24(29)26-18-11-13-19(14-12-18)30-16-23(28)27-15-5-7-17-6-1-4-10-22(17)27/h1-4,6,8-14H,5,7,15-16H2,(H,26,29).
What are the key properties of N-[4-[2-(3,4-dihydro-2H-quinolin-1-yl)-2-oxoethyl]sulfanylphenyl]-2-fluorobenzamide?
N-[4-[2-(3,4-dihydro-2H-quinolin-1-yl)-2-oxoethyl]sulfanylphenyl]-2-fluorobenzamide has a molecular weight of 420.51 g/mol, XLogP of 5.15, 5 rotatable bonds, 1 hydrogen bond donors, and 3 hydrogen bond acceptors.
